Role Summary

EQ Retirement Solutions are looking for a Client Reporting Manager. As a Client Reporting Manager, you will lead a team responsible for maintaining and reconciling client account records, ensuring compliance with tax requirements, and producing management reports and annual accounts for a portfolio of clients. You will provide technical guidance, support team development, and liaise with clients to meet service needs. This role requires strong pensions accounting expertise, attention to detail, and the ability to manage multiple client relationships and SLAs effectively.

Core Duties/Responsibilities

  • Team Leadership: Line manage accounting staff, set objectives, review development plans, and drive engagement.
  • Financial Reporting: Draft pension scheme financial statements and annual reports in line with legislation and best practice; prepare periodic financial and management reports.
  • Audit & Compliance: Facilitate audits, manage audit planning, ensure compliance with financial controls and quality standards, and coordinate AAF audit responsibilities.
  • Payments & Reconciliations: Authorise payments, review reconciliations, and oversee banking platform administration and mandates.
  • Tax & Regulatory Reporting: Prepare/review SA970 tax returns, quarterly tax accounting, and ONS returns; ensure timely HMRC submissions.
  • Client Support: Handle escalations, provide technical guidance, and maintain strong client relationships.
  • Technical Expertise: Act as SME for pensions accounting, VAT, AFT, SORP, FRS102, and system implementations (SunSystems). Deliver technical training and maintain departmental SOPs.
  • Projects & Process Improvement: Lead remediation projects, manage client onboarding/exits, oversee system upgrades, and implement process improvements.
  • Resource & People Management: Plan resources, liaise with HR and recruitment, mentor senior staff, and manage performance reviews.
  • Cross-Team Collaboration: Build relationships across operations, treasury, and professional advisers; represent EQ Retirement Solutions at PRAG.
